The Vegetarian Flavor Bible


Book Description

Throughout time, people have chosen to adopt a vegetarian or vegan diet for a variety of reasons, from ethics to economy to personal and planetary well-being. Experts now suggest a new reason for doing so: maximizing flavor -- which is too often masked by meat-based stocks or butter and cream. The Vegetarian Flavor Bible is an essential guide to culinary creativity, based on insights from dozens of leading American chefs, representing such acclaimed restaurants as Crossroads and M.A.K.E. in Los Angeles; Candle 79, Dirt Candy, and Kajitsu in New York City, Green Zebra in Chicago, Greens and Millennium in San Francisco, Natural Selection and Portobello in Portland, Plum Bistro in Seattle, and Vedge in Philadelphia. Emphasizing plant-based whole foods including vegetables, fruits,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ds, the book provides an A-to-Z listing of hundreds of ingredients, from avßav? to zucchini blossoms, cross-referenced with the herbs, spices, and other seasonings that best enhance their flavor, resulting in thousands of recommended pairings. The Vegetarian Flavor Bible is the ideal reference for the way millions of people cook and eat today -- vegetarians, vegans, and omnivores alike. This groundbreaking book will empower both home cooks and professional chefs to create more compassionate, healthful, and flavorful cuisine.

In recent years, the vegan lifestyle has gained immense popularity, and for good reason. A vegan diet, which excludes all animal products, offers numerous health benefits that can transform your life. Whether you are looking to improve your overall well-being or are simply seeking a new and exciting way to eat, embracing a vegan diet can be a game-changer. One of the primary advantages of a vegan diet is its positive impact on your health. Research has shown that individuals who follow a plant-based diet have lower rates of heart disease, high blood pressure, and certain types of cancer. Vegan diets are typically low in saturated fat and cholesterol, while being rich in nutrients such as fiber, vitamins, and minerals. By eliminating meat and dairy from your diet, you can reduce your risk of chronic diseases and enjoy a longer, healthier life. Another benefit of a vegan diet is weight management. Many people struggle with weight issues, but a vegan diet can provide a natural solution. Plant-based foods tend to be lower in calories and higher in fiber, promoting satiety and preventing overeating. F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and legumes are staples of a vegan diet and are packed with essential nutrients while being low in fat. By adopting a vegan lifestyle, you can achieve and maintain a healthy weight without feeling deprived or hungry. Additionally, a vegan diet can contribute to a more sustainable and eco-friendly world. Animal agriculture is a leading cause of deforestation, greenhouse gas emissions, and water pollution. By choosing plant-based alternatives, you are reducing your carbon footprint and helping to preserve our planet for future generations. Vegan diets also save countless animals from suffering in factory farms, fostering compassion and kindness towards all living beings. Finally, a vegan diet can open up a world of culinary possibilities. Contrary to popular belief, vegan recipes are anything but boring. With a wide range of f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, and plant-based proteins, you can create delicious and flavorful meals that will satisfy even the most discerning palate. From hearty stews and vibrant salads to decadent desserts, the vegan kitchen offers limitless creativity and taste.
